barcode verification

Barcode verification is a process used to ensure that barcodes are correctly printed and can be accurately read by scanners. It involves analyzing the barcode’s quality, including its clarity, contrast, and the precision of the lines and spacing, to confirm it meets industry standards. This ensures that the barcode will reliably identify products during tracking and checkout, reducing errors and improving inventory management. Verification is essential for quality control, especially in regulated industries like healthcare and manufacturing, where accurate data capture is critical. Essentially, it helps maintain consistent, scannable barcodes for smooth operations.
